The 5 steps to eliminate the smell of sweat from clothes

Do you know how the smell of sweat is caused? Sweat at its source is odourless. What causes the bad smell in the body, like when we sweat, are the bacteria that are part of our natural bacterial flora, which feed on the sweat itself. The apocrine sweat glands are found mostly in the armpits. Here humidity, body sebum and dirt provide a favourable environment for bacteria to grow in greater proportion. By feeding on our sweat, bad-smelling waste substances are generated, which is what we commonly know as a bad smell of sweat.

With these 5 simple steps you will eliminate the smell of sweat from clothes by attacking the root of the problem:

  1. Do not leave your garments smelling of sweat in the laundry basket since this can promote the spread of bacteria. If you are away from home, we recommend that you always carry a bag to store sweaty clothing and separate it from other things until you can wash it.
  2. Wash your garments as soon as possible. In these cases, the longer the garment smells of sweat, the more the bacteria it causes will penetrate the textile and the more difficult it will be to remove the smell. If you cannot wash the clothes immediately, let them air. This will weaken the bad smell and therefore make it easier to remove.
  3. Use a high temperature (60ºC) wash cycle if your clothes allow it, to be sure that the high temperature of the water, in addition to Sanytol’s disinfecting power, kills all the germs there may be in your clothes.

  2. Hang the laundry as soon as the wash cycle is finished. This is ideally done outdoors, but if this is not possible, either due to limitations or bad weather, you will have to do it indoors. It is very important that you let it dry completely before gathering it up and storing it to avoid any traces of moisture that may favour the proliferation of micro-organisms and cause the bad smell to reappear on your clothes.
